// Fixture: three-node mock of the Renderbarn transcoding farm.
// Jobs submitted here never touch real encoder hosts; the stub
// scheduler assigns them round-robin and completes each in 50 ms.
// New folks: note that the fixture enforces the same preset
// validation as production, so a malformed ladder config fails
// fast here too. Output manifests land in the temp bucket and are
// wiped after each test run. The mock control-plane API still
// requires authentication, and all fixture requests use the
// bearer token on the following line.

session JWT of yawep-yawep = eyJhbGciOiJIUzI1NiIsInR5cCI6IkpXVCJ9.eyJzdWIiOiI3pWF3_In0.aXYsHiog

Finance Review Summary — Tollard Appliances

Warranty costs for the Cindermere heater line exceeded the quarterly provision by a significant margin, driven by a faulty thermostat batch. Remediation and replacement logistics are underway, and the supplier has acknowledged liability in principle. Provisions for the next two quarters have been increased accordingly. Margin impact is contained but material. The board should note the implications for next year's product roadmap, which are set out in the confidential note below.

management briefing: The renewal with Zoraelax Group closes at $10 million a year, 15 percent below the last contract. Project Ralael slips by six weeks because of the audit delay.

**09:41 — Compression flip backfires.** Enabled permessage-deflate on the Foxglove relay to cut bandwidth. CPU on edge nodes spiked 3x; reconnect latency doubled. 09:58: rolled back. Lesson: our payloads are already compact JSON; deflate overhead dominates. Contractors: do not re-enable without load-test sign-off from the Marloway team. Rollback shipped under the build token below.

pipeline stamp: htk9_ce63042d9